Pancreatitis (inflammation of the pancreas): Symptoms may include severe upper abdominal pain that doesnt go away, vomiting, and nausea Gallbladder disease (gallstones or gallbladder inflammation): Symptoms may include sudden and intense abdominal pain, nausea, vomiting, fever and chills Kidney problems: Changes in urination (either going more or less frequently), along with swelling in feet and ankles Hypersensitivity or allergic reactions (including anaphylaxis ): Shortness of breath, itching and swelling near the injection site, dizziness Diabetic retinopathy: People with type 2 diabetes and a history of diabetic retinopathy (a complication that affects the blood vessels in the eye) may experience worsening symptoms, including blurred vision, spots, and floaters : Symptoms include fast heartbeat, shakiness, dizziness, and confusion
